Lectures On Prayer is a book written by A Country Pastor in 1860 that explores the topic of prayer from a Christian perspective. The book is a collection of lectures that were originally delivered to a congregation, and it is written in a conversational style that is easy to understand. The author discusses the purpose and importance of prayer, as well as different types of prayer such as praise, thanksgiving, confession, and intercession. He also provides guidance on how to pray effectively, including tips on how to focus and avoid distractions. The book emphasizes the power of prayer and encourages readers to make it a regular part of their spiritual lives.
